Job Responsibility:
Responsible for supervising all the production and sanitation activities through the various shift leadspersons
Train, direct and motivate Team members to achieve department goals and stands on yield, quality, productivity and safety
Responsible for his/her respective department and for meeting department goals and standards on quality, yield, productivity, cost and safety
Directly responsible for the development and training of Team members, working within the guidelines of the union contract and company policies
Directly responsible for monitoring standards and indexes needed to control area of responsibility
Responsible for quick and timely feedback to supervisor on all exception in regard to productivity, downtime, quality, yield, cost and safety
Responsible for making sure all preventive maintenance is done on all equipment in area of control and interfacing with immediate Supervisor on all suggested changes that would make the job better, more profitable and safer
Directly responsible for giving safety orientations and holding safety/general meetings as required
Requirements:
Must have a B.S. or B.A. degree in Business Management or equivalent work experience
Must have a minimum of 3 years' experience in the food processing industry
Must have demonstrated ability communicate verbally in writing and must have strong interpersonal skills
Must have a balanced technical/mechanical/human resource knowledge
Must be able to evaluate line Team members fairly and objectively
Must have the ability to interface on a daily basis with all support groups or departments
Bilingual in English/Spanish prefferred
Must be able to submit and pass a criminal background check
